Davin McCall
|
9c8efd58b2
dinictl: report launch stage and error for exec failure
|
2 years ago |
Davin McCall
|
b5aae5f9ac
Record exec failure reason in service record
|
2 years ago |
Davin McCall
|
ca977d5746
Documentation update: stop-command for process/bgprocess
|
2 years ago |
Davin McCall
|
8b3f67fc46
Add some tests, fix some other tests
|
2 years ago |
Davin McCall
|
bad1a74fd5
Don't let bgprocess reach stopped if waiting for exec status
|
2 years ago |
Davin McCall
|
2503b752ed
Allow specifying stop-command for bgprocess services
|
2 years ago |
Davin McCall
|
1c25cba417
Refactor bgprocess_service as a subclass of process_service
|
2 years ago |
Davin McCall
|
19b75cb091
De-register stop watcher using correct PID
|
2 years ago |
Davin McCall
|
1d757bd2ff
Ensure stop_issued goes false on stop
|
2 years ago |
Davin McCall
|
9b3befd497
Implement stop-command support for normal process services
|
2 years ago |
Davin McCall
|
b66360a580
Add (passing) test
|
2 years ago |
Davin McCall
|
8cdf5e89ac
Fix incorrect state when bgproc is stopped in certain conditions
|
2 years ago |
Davin McCall
|
c88bbdb204
Fix rollback when adding dependency fails (caught by GCC 11)
|
2 years ago |
Davin McCall
|
e3231e3374
bgproc: properly clear smooth recovery flag if recovery fails
|
2 years ago |
Davin McCall
|
48615c8e51
CP test for service status
|
2 years ago |
Davin McCall
|
60cb1a4df0
Fix off-by-one in handling STATUS requests
|
2 years ago |
Davin McCall
|
bceda827ba
Add .github metadata (funding)
|
2 years ago |
Davin McCall
|
b881ff8b24
pre-bump version (0.14.0pre)
|
2 years ago |
Davin McCall
|
871edc9ae5
Use mandoc to generate html manpages
|
2 years ago |
Davin McCall
|
a0b3c07130
Rename BUILD.txt to just BUILD (better consistency)
|
2 years ago |
Davin McCall
|
83b30ba325
Examples should be a top-level section
|
2 years ago |
Davin McCall
|
5b661d9eda
Update README, COMPARISON
|
2 years ago |
Davin McCall
|
43de889a3d
Bump version in NEWS
|
2 years ago |
Davin McCall
|
bfcbcc87ef
Bump version: 0.14
|
2 years ago |
Davin McCall
|
abdf7ac4a2
Only re-open stdin/out/err if we are system manager
|
2 years ago |
Davin McCall
|
7e75365c62
Re-work build slightly; only build mconfig from top-level
|
2 years ago |
Davin McCall
|
100669052f
Avoid accidental creation of string temporary
|
2 years ago |
Davin McCall
|
3e645a4b27
Rework argument processing in dinitctl
|
2 years ago |
Davin McCall
|
adc0299191
Add cheatsheat for roff/man formatting etc
|
2 years ago |
Davin McCall
|
f84a240890
Formatting and other fixes for man pages
|
2 years ago |